First, you need to understand that height is generally determined by your genes. If the people in your family are not that tall, then you may probably shove off the plan to be very tall. It can be quite impossible and frustrating in the end. It is very important that you understand the limits. Of course, you can add some centimeters to your height but never expect too much if it is not in your genes. Second, you need to avoid things that could inhibit your growth. There are certain foods and things that can mess up with your growth even at the early stage. For instance, you should avoid drinking alcohol and other drugs. It is said that the substances in them inhibit the growth of the bones therefore you cannot achieve your maximum height potential. Nutrient deficiency also plays a big role in inhibiting the growth of your bones. You need to make sure that you are eating healthy and that you calcium intake is stable to keep the bones strong. Aside from your diet, your posture can also affect your height. Always maintain a proper posture in order for your bones to grow steadily. Slouching is not good for you. Third, you need to sleep right. Sleep is very important as it helps in making your body to regenerate and to produce new cells better. During deep sleep, the body renews damaged cells and produces new ones. This includes the bone cells as well. Therefore, it is very important to maintain a good quality of sleep. You can do this by making sure that your sleeping environment is good. For instance, you can sleep in a dim and sound proof room in order to not be disturbed by lights or by noises around you. Drinking milk or calming tea before bedtime will also help you in getting a good sleep. Fourth, improve your diet. The food you eat can affect the development of your body, including your bones. In order to grow taller, you need to make sure that you are providing your body the necessary vitamins and minerals for a healthy lifestyle. Of course, you need to eat foods that are rich in calcium such as milk and other dairy products. You can also get calcium from vegetables. This will help in making your bones stronger and will also keep you away from bone problems such as osteoporosis. Vitamin D from fishes or from the sun is also important especially for children. This vitamin improves the health of the muscles as well as the bones. Protein is also important in making sure that your body is growing healthily and steadily. Each meal that you take should be complete. This means that the 3 food groups should be present - go, glow and grow.
